Playground: Numurkah District Health, VIC


In March 2012, Numurkah and surrounding districts were devastated by floods. These floods caused severe damage to the local hospital, causing the building to be demolished and rebuilt.

Prior to the flood, there was an old-fashioned pine playground positioned out the front of the health service.

This playground was of course very popular with children and visiting relatives of the hospital and a crucial part of the inclusion in the rebuild of the facilities.

With the addition of a General Practice, Dental and pathology services to the new Hospital and Community Health buildings we anticipate the need for a modern playground for children who will be attending the service themselves or visiting relatives.

The hospital presented to KidzFix the need for a bright, safe, inviting area for children, many of whom have not just suffered through illness but also through floods and more recently the fires that have affected the area.

For us, it was a clear need, directly supporting sick children and impacting their experience in hospital and other health services, ultimately improving their chance of recovery.
